What you can expect

Explore the town hall of Florence on a 2-hour tour of Palazzo Vecchio. Visit the private apartments of the Medici family and climb to the top of the tower of Arnolfo to see Signoria Square from above.

You will visit with an expert local guide Palazzo Vecchio (Old Palace), each room decorated by artistic geniuses to celebrate the triumph of Cosimo I de’ Medici. The tour will start from the ground floor with the famous and prestigious courtyard of Michelozzo, going up to the ground floor you will discover the magnificence of the “Salone dei Cinquecento” (Hall of the Five Hundred), the largest room in Florence with his extension of 54 metres long by 22 metres wide and 17 metres high sumptuously frescoed by Vasari on the walls and on the coffered ceiling, and finely embellished with statues including the Genius of Victory by Michelangelo Buonarroti.

You will continue admiring the ducal apartments and Eleonora da Toledo’s rooms, the first Grand Duchess of Tuscany, with paintings by the major Mannerist painters, such as Bronzino

You will visit the Sala dei Gigli where you will find the original bronze statue of Judith and Holofernes by Donatello, undisputed genius of the Renaissance and inspirer of Michelangelo.
